Does Chrysler have a powertrain warranty?

Chrysler offers a powertrain limited warranty that covers the vehicle’s powertrain (engine, transmission, drive system) for 5 years/60,000 miles. In California and states that have adopted its zero-emission vehicle (ZEV) regulations, the battery pack coverage is 10 years/150,000 miles, whichever comes first.

When did Chrysler offer lifetime powertrain warranty?

In July 2007, Fiat Chrysler made an announcement that it would start to offer a lifetime warranty on 88 percent of its fleet models, the plaintiffs allege. From 2007 to 2009, the drivers claim that Fiat Chrysler sold hundreds of thousands of vehicles by providing these lifetime warranty assurances to vehicle owners.

What does a 100 000 mile powertrain warranty cover?

What does the new 5-Year / 100,000-Mile Powertrain Limited Warranty include? The powertrain limited warranty covers the cost of all parts and labor needed to repair a covered powertrain component – engine, transmission and drive system – on most new Chrysler, Dodge and Jeep® brand vehicles.

When did Chrysler Stop lifetime warranty?

2010
Chrysler Group LLC is discontinuing its lifetime powertrain warranty beginning with 2010 models. In its place will be five-year, 100,000- mile warranty. The new warranties will be transferable if covered vehicles are resold during the warranty period.

Is starter included in powertrain warranty?

Do not assume the starter, which gets the gasoline engine running, is covered under a powertrain warranty. It might instead be covered under the “electrical” section of a factory warranty, a CPO warranty, or an extended warranty. This can vary by brand, so consult your warranty booklet or ask the dealer to clarify.

What is a powertrain warranty and what does it cover?

Simply put, this is a warranty on components of the vehicle’s propulsion system, such as the engine, transmission and other related pieces such as the differential. Powertrain warranties also often cover just about anything involved in bringing power to the wheels, including a car’s driveshaft and constant velocity joints.
